General annotation (Comments)

Function

Catalyzes the NADPH-dependent reduction of 7-cyano-7-deazaguanine (preQ0) to 7-aminomethyl-7-deazaguanine (preQ1) By similarity.

Catalytic activity

7-aminomethyl-7-carbaguanine + 2 NADP+ = 7-cyano-7-carbaguanine + 2 NADPH. HAMAP MF_00817

Pathway

tRNA modification; tRNA-queuosine biosynthesis. HAMAP MF_00817

Subcellular location

Cytoplasm Probable.

Sequence similarities

Belongs to the GTP cyclohydrolase I family. QueF type 2 subfamily.
